Bottle, 330 ml shared with Simon and Miro B. Dark brown, small beige head. Malty, caramel, dried fruit, tad spicy, sweet, medium to full bodied.

Bottled 330ml. -from Roybeer Milano. Brown coloured, small to medium sized off-white head, dried fruits, yeast and alcohol in the nose. Moderate sweet malty, dried fruits, yeast, caramel, light spices and noticable alcohol presence.

hazy dark amber to brown colour, medium sized beige-ish off-white head; aroma of raisins, dried cherry, dark chocolate, grape juice, some cognac and biscuit notes; taste of dark chocolate, dried cherry, raisins soaked in alcohol, slight walnut notes, toffee and biscuits; good quadrupel

0,33l bottle from Beergium. Mid brown beer with small and quickly vanishing head. Aroma has sweet sugar, booze and some dark fruits. Taste has sugar, dark fruits, raisins and booze. Medium+ body, a bit dry at the end.
